How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Muldoon?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Muldoon Studio Apartments | $1,391 | $825 | $1,832 |
Muldoon 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,474 | $632 | $3,037 |
Muldoon 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,827 | $812 | $3,999 |
Muldoon 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,159 | $999 | $5,690 |
Muldoon 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,201 | $1,599 | $4,868 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Muldoon
How much are Studio apartments in Muldoon?
There are currently 7 Studio Apartments in Muldoon with rent ranges from $825 to $1,832 with an average price of $1,391.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Muldoon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Muldoon ranges from $632 to $3,037 with an average monthly rent of $1,474.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Muldoon c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Muldoon range from $812 to $3,999.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,827.
How expensive are Muldoon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 25 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Muldoon on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$999 to $5,690 - averaging $2,159 for the location.
